How to Watch the 2022 Oscars Live

ABC: Your Traditional Option

First and foremost, the Oscars are traditionally broadcasted on ABC. If you have a cable subscription that includes ABC, then you're golden! Just tune in on the big night and enjoy the show. But what if you've ditched cable? Don't fret! ABC is available through several streaming services. These services offer live TV packages that include ABC, giving you the same experience as cable without the commitment.

Streaming services like Hulu + Live TV, YouTube TV, and AT&T TV (now DirecTV Stream) are your best bet. These services offer a variety of channels, including ABC, and often come with perks like cloud DVR storage, so you can record the show and watch it later if you happen to miss it live. Plus, most of these services offer free trials, so you can sign up, watch the Oscars, and then decide if you want to continue the subscription. It's like test-driving a car, but instead of a car, it's a night of Hollywood drama.

But, before you jump on the bandwagon, double-check that ABC is available in your local market. Some streaming services don't offer local channels in all areas, so it's always a good idea to confirm before you sign up. Streaming Services: Cutting the Cord

Speaking of streaming, let's dive deeper into the options for cord-cutters. Streaming services have revolutionized the way we watch TV, and they offer a convenient and affordable alternative to cable. As mentioned earlier, Hulu + Live TV, YouTube TV, and DirecTV Stream are all excellent choices for watching the Oscars live. But let's break down each option a little further.

Hulu + Live TV: This service offers a comprehensive package of live TV channels, including ABC, as well as access to Hulu's extensive on-demand library. This means you can watch the Oscars live and then binge-watch your favorite shows the next day. It's the best of both worlds!

YouTube TV: With YouTube TV, you get a similar experience to Hulu + Live TV, with a wide range of live TV channels and unlimited DVR storage. This is perfect for those who like to record everything and watch it later. Plus, YouTube TV has a user-friendly interface that's easy to navigate.

DirecTV Stream: This service offers a variety of packages, with different channel lineups to choose from. If you're looking for a more premium experience, DirecTV Stream might be the way to go. However, it's also one of the more expensive options.
